HYPE Coin Plummets 6%: Technical Disruptions Trigger 99-Day Trend Reversal

HYPE Coin, the native token of the Hyperliquid platform, has seen a sharp 6% decline amid technical disruptions and broader market instability. This downturn marks a significant reversal of its 99-day upward trend, leaving investors concerned about its short-term prospects. Here’s what you need to know.
HYPE Coin Faces Technical Disruptions
The Hyperliquid platform has been grappling with technical issues affecting its smart contracts and order placement system. Users have reported malfunctions, though the team has yet to issue an official statement. These disruptions have contributed to the token’s recent drop, with prices now 16% below their peak.
Crypto Market Instability Compounds the Problem
The decline in HYPE Coin coincides with a broader slump in the crypto market. Bitcoin (BTC) has dipped below $117,600, while Ethereum (ETH) struggles to regain momentum. Analysts warn that prolonged technical issues could push HYPE Coin toward a critical support range of $40.1–$36.9.
Macroeconomic Factors Add to the Pressure
Market sentiment remains fragile due to macroeconomic uncertainties. Recent U.S. labor data and consumer confidence reports suggest minimal pressure for Federal Reserve rate cuts, reinforcing downward pressure on risk assets. Traders are closely watching the Fed’s upcoming meeting for signals on potential rate adjustments.
